75 Hemp or Hemp Extract intended for Human Consumption is distributed or sold in packaging that does not include the expiration date. s. 581.217(7)(a)2.d., F.S. and 5K-4.034(6)(a), F.A.C..
Retail: Hemp extract products located on shelf in glass display case not properly labeled with expiration date on label. COS: Food establishment has voluntarily decided to discarded hemp extract products without expiration dates on label. See Supplement. x
75 The scannable barcode or quick response code as required in Section 581.217(7) (a)2., F.S., does not link directly to a webpage where the required certificate of analysis may be found in three or fewer steps. 5K-4.034(6)(k), F.A.C.
Retail: Hemp extract products located on shelf in glass display case not does not have a scannable barcode or quick response code that links to a webpage containing a certificate of analysis in 3 or fewer steps. COS: Manager has decided to voluntarily discarded hemp extract products without a scannable barcode or quick response code that links in 3 or fewer steps. See Supplement. x
75 Hemp and Hemp Extract intended for Human Consumption does not declare the number of milligrams of each cannabinoid per serving and the serving size on the label. 5K-4.034(6)(c), F.A.C.
Retail: Hemp extract products located on shelf in glass display case not properly labeled with number of milligrams of each cannabinoid per serving and no serving size stated on package. COS: The food establishment has voluntarily decided to discarded hemp extract products without serving size on label. See Supplement. x
77 Distribution or sale of a Hemp or Hemp Extract intended for Human Consumption that is attractive to children in violation of s. 581.217(7)(e), F.S. The Hemp or Hemp Extract package, label, or advertisement for the product, is in the shape of humans, cartoons, or animals in violation of 5K-4.034(6) (b), F.A.C.
Retail: Hemp Extract products observed to be Attractive to Children - product and/or labels in the shape of an animal, human, or cartoon; or bears any resemblance to an existing candy product. COS: Manager has decided to voluntarily discarded hemp extract products deemed to be attractive to children. See Supplement. x Print Date: 3/10/2026 Page 1 of 3

Print Date: 3/10/2026 Page 5 of 6 When the department or its duly authorized agent finds, or has probable cause to believe, that any food or food-processing equipment is in violation of this chapter or any rule adopted under this chapter so as to be dangerous, unwholesome, fraudulent, or insanitary within the meaning of this chapter, an agent of the department may issue and enforce a stop-sale, stop-use, removal, or hold order, which order gives notice that such article or processing equipment is, or is suspected of being, in violation and has been detained or embargoed and which order warns all persons not to remove, use, or dispose of such article or processing equipment by sale or otherwise until permission for removal, use, or disposal is given by the department or the court. It is unlawful for any person to remove, use, or dispose of such detained or embargoed article or processing equipment by sale or otherwise without such permission in accordance with 500.172 (1) Florida Statutes.
